How ALEKS Actually Works

ALEKS (Assessment and Learning in Knowledge Spaces) doesn’t test you with a fixed list of questions. It’s built on a model called Knowledge Space Theory, which continuously maps what you currently know against everything you’d need to know within a subject, then picks each next question specifically to narrow down your actual knowledge state — not to check a box on a topic list. That’s why two students can take the “same” ALEKS assessment and see completely different sets of questions.

Why It’s Not a Normal Multiple-Choice Test

There’s no multiple choice on ALEKS — you type answers, plot points, or build equations directly, and the system doesn’t just check whether your final number matches; it’s continuously updating a model of what you’re likely to know next based on how you answered everything before. This is the core reason “just look up the answer” strategies tend to fail: getting one question right by lookup only pushes you into harder related questions your actual knowledge can’t support, and the system adjusts quickly. A single gamed answer doesn’t move your placement much — a pattern of them tends to produce a score that doesn’t hold up once you’re in coursework that assumes you actually know the material.

The Legitimate Way to Use AI to Pass ALEKS Faster

Here’s where AI is genuinely useful — not during the graded assessment itself, but during ALEKS’s Learning Mode, the untimed practice environment where you work through topics before they’re tested.

Using AI as a Concept Explainer, Not an Answer Generator

When you hit a topic in Learning Mode you don’t understand, a tool like ChatGPT can explain the underlying concept in plain language, walk through a similar example step by step, and answer follow-up questions until it actually clicks — which is a meaningfully faster way to build understanding than re-reading a textbook explanation that didn’t work the first time. The key distinction: ask it to explain the method and work through a similar problem, not to solve your actual ALEKS problem for you, since the point is understanding you can apply to the next, different question ALEKS shows you.

Using AI to Generate Extra Practice on Your Weak Topics

ALEKS’s pie chart shows you exactly which topics you haven’t mastered yet. This is especially useful for topics with a specific mechanical skill (factoring, solving systems of equations, working with exponent rules) where repetition genuinely builds fluency.

Using AI to Decode ALEKS’s Math Input Format

A surprisingly common source of lost points isn’t math knowledge at all — it’s ALEKS’s input tools (its equation editor, graphing interface, and specific notation requirements) tripping students up even when they know the right answer. AI tools can walk you through how to correctly input a fraction, an inequality, or a graphed line in ALEKS’s specific format, which is a legitimate use that has nothing to do with the actual math being assessed and everything to do with removing a friction point that costs real students real points.

Understanding ALEKS Proctoring: What’s Actually Monitored

Whether and how closely your ALEKS assessment is proctored depends entirely on your specific institution and course — this isn’t something ALEKS applies uniformly, so check your course syllabus or the assessment instructions directly rather than assuming. Some placement assessments run with no additional proctoring software at all; others require Respondus LockDown Browser (which restricts your computer to the ALEKS window, blocking other tabs and applications) sometimes paired with Respondus Monitor or a more active tool like Honorlock, which uses webcam analysis and can flag things like a second device in view, sustained eye movement away from the screen, or another voice in the room.

Separately from live proctoring, ALEKS’s own reporting tools — used by instructors reviewing your progress, not as real-time surveillance — track learning patterns like unusually fast correct answers on hard problems following a run of struggles, or a mismatch between strong practice performance and weak Knowledge Check results. This isn’t the same as active cheating detection, but it’s the most common reason an instructor follows up with a student about their ALEKS progress, and it’s a direct consequence of trying to shortcut the assessment rather than build the underlying skill.

The ALEKS Retake Process and How to Use It Strategically

ALEKS placement assessments are typically retakeable, but not immediately or unlimited — most institutions require a minimum number of hours in the Prep and Learning Module (working through the specific topics ALEKS identified as weak) before you’re allowed to retake, often with a waiting period of a day or more and a cap on total attempts. This structure is actually useful strategically: rather than treating a lower first score as a failure, treat it as ALEKS handing you a precise list of exactly what to study before the retake, then use that mandatory prep window with AI-assisted practice on precisely those topics rather than generic review.

A Realistic Study Plan Using AI Before Your Assessment

  • Take (or review) your ALEKS pie chart first. Identify the specific weak topics rather than studying broadly — this is your actual roadmap, and ALEKS has already built it for you.
  • Use AI to explain each weak topic conceptually, asking for a plain-language walkthrough and one worked example before you attempt ALEKS’s own practice problems on that topic.
  • Drill with AI-generated extra practice on the two or three topics you’re weakest in, since ALEKS’s own practice set for a topic is often not enough repetition to build real fluency on its own.
  • Practice ALEKS’s specific input format for anything unfamiliar (fraction entry, graphing tools, equation editors) so format friction doesn’t cost you points you actually know.
  • Use your mandatory prep window before a retake deliberately, focusing entirely on the topics your pie chart flagged rather than re-reviewing material you’ve already mastered.

Common Mistakes Students Make With ALEKS Prep

Trying to answer ALEKS questions directly with AI during the graded assessment. Beyond the proctoring risk on monitored assessments, this produces a score that doesn’t hold up once related material is tested, and can result in more, not less, required coursework.

Studying broadly instead of using the pie chart. ALEKS tells you exactly what to review — ignoring that and re-studying topics you’ve already mastered wastes the limited time before a retake.

Losing points to input-format confusion, not math knowledge. Not practicing ALEKS’s specific equation editor and graphing tools before the real assessment is one of the most avoidable sources of lost points.

Assuming all ALEKS assessments are proctored the same way (or not at all). Proctoring requirements vary by institution and course — checking your specific syllabus rather than assuming avoids an unpleasant surprise.

Not using the required retake waiting period productively. The mandatory prep hours before a retake are a genuine opportunity to close specific gaps — skipping meaningful practice during that window and just waiting out the clock wastes it.

FAQs About Using AI to Pass ALEKS

Can you use AI to answer questions directly on the ALEKS test? Technically possible in some unproctored contexts, but it tends to backfire — ALEKS’s adaptive model responds to a lucky or borrowed answer with harder related questions you likely can’t answer, and where proctoring is required, it carries real academic-integrity risk.

Does ALEKS detect AI or cheating? Not through direct AI-detection software in most configurations, but it tracks learning patterns (unusual pacing, a mismatch between practice performance and Knowledge Check results) that instructors can review, and proctored assessments (via Respondus or Honorlock) add webcam and browser-lockdown monitoring depending on your institution’s requirements.

How many times can you retake the ALEKS placement test? This varies by institution, but most set a maximum number of attempts (commonly around five) with a required minimum number of Prep and Learning Module hours and a waiting period between each retake — check your specific school’s policy rather than assuming a universal number.

What happens if you fail the ALEKS placement test? There’s no pass/fail in the traditional sense — your score determines which math course you’re placed into, so a lower score typically means starting at a more foundational course level rather than an outright failure, though this can mean additional non-credit coursework depending on your program.

Is the ALEKS test proctored? It depends entirely on your institution and course — some run with no additional proctoring software, others require Respondus LockDown Browser and/or Monitor, or a more actively monitored tool like Honorlock. Check your course syllabus or assessment instructions directly to confirm.

What’s a good ALEKS score? This depends entirely on which math course you’re trying to place into — each institution sets its own score thresholds for each course level, so check your specific school’s published placement chart rather than assuming a universal “good” score.

Can I use a calculator on ALEKS? ALEKS includes a built-in calculator that’s automatically enabled or disabled depending on whether the specific topic is meant to test calculator-free skills — this is built into the platform itself rather than something you control, and outside calculators or scratch paper use typically require instructor permission per your course’s specific rules.

How long should I study before retaking ALEKS? Most institutions require a minimum number of Prep and Learning Module hours (commonly a few hours at minimum) before a retake is unlocked, but using that time on your specific weak topics from your pie chart — rather than the bare minimum — tends to produce a meaningfully better retake score.

What’s the fastest legitimate way to improve my ALEKS score? Focus study time specifically on the topics your ALEKS pie chart identifies as unmastered, using AI to get clear explanations and extra practice on exactly those topics, rather than reviewing broadly or attempting to shortcut the assessment itself.

Is it worth paying for an ALEKS prep service? It depends on what the service actually offers — legitimate tutoring or structured practice on your specific weak topics can genuinely help, while any service offering to take the assessment for you or guarantee a score through gamed answers carries real academic-integrity risk and tends to produce a placement that doesn’t hold up once you’re in the actual coursework.
